Differentiation: definition and basic derivative rules

Differentiation: definition and basic derivative rules

Sat 2:30 PM - 3:45 PM UTCSep 27, 2:30 PM - 3:45 PM UTC

We will introduce the derivative using limits, emphasizing visual intuition. We will go over the sum rule and power rule, and thus learn how to differentiate polynomials. We will then progress onto the product, quotient and chain rule, time permitting.

Differentiation: composite, implicit, and inverse functions

Differentiation: composite, implicit, and inverse functions

Sun 2:30 PM - 3:45 PM UTCSep 28, 2:30 PM - 3:45 PM UTC

We will review the previous session, giving many practice problems. Then, we will go over implicit and parametric differentiation, as well as learning how to differentiate inverse functions.

Lastly, we will understand the applications of the derivative, including finding the maxima/minima of the function (first derivative test) as well as its nature (second derivative test), and related rates.
